Output deabfa1e8784cfa3c2ee8a70431d4d99f9b42f25db72aa0f089e07a4927fd9ab:7

value
10075489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5a4f7ea17cbe367087ce1c4c2172eb422a3e6d OP_EQUAL
address
35v7CFeNQmtuQzYqQfP4RJkoMwNDpomsP8
transaction
deabfa1e8784cfa3c2ee8a70431d4d99f9b42f25db72aa0f089e07a4927fd9ab
confirmations
400431
spent
true